sql >> データベース >  >> RDS >> Mysql

過去30日間のmysql結果の取得

    これを試してください

    select * from `table` where `yourfield` >= DATE_SUB(CURDATE(), INTERVAL 3 MONTH)
    

    日、年については、たとえば以下を参照してください。

    DATE_SUB(CURDATE(), INTERVAL 15 DAY) /*For getting record specific days*/
    
    DATE_SUB(CURDATE(), INTERVAL 1 YEAR) /*for getting records specific years*/
    

    Anandの場合、query
    BETWEEN DATE_SUB( CURDATE( ) ,INTERVAL 6 MONTH ) AND DATE_SUB( CURDATE() ,INTERVAL 3 MONTH ) 
    /* For Getting records between last 6 month to last 3 month
    


    1. MySQLの「順序付け」-英数字を正しく並べ替える

    2. ContentProviderを使用してデータベース操作を処理することは良い習慣ですか?

    3. n個のグループ化されたカテゴリを取得し、他のカテゴリを1つに合計します

    4. WordPressWebサイトのデータベースフェイルオーバー